Two months later.

Endless Fantasy Legend 2 officially went live!

Early that day, Zhuge Jun and Hou Ji arrived at Nitiandang’s virtual experience store, eager to snag the best spots.

However, once they secured their positions, Zhuge Jun looked around and noticed Gu Fan’s absence.

"Hmm, President Gu didn’t show up after all.

"Figures, as the big boss, there’s already a thick barrier between us gamers and him!"

In reality, playing Endless Fantasy Legend 2 on one’s personal computer was no different; the high-end PCs and consoles at the experience store didn’t hold much advantage in that respect.

Although the graphics would indeed improve, including better haptic feedback from controllers and game optimizations, Endless Fantasy Legend 2 was a well-optimized game that didn’t demand high specs.

Still, Zhuge Jun and Hou Ji came to the experience store mainly in the hopes of seeing President Gu once again.

After all, President Gu often appeared at the store for new game releases and new product collaborations.

But not this time.

Hou Ji pondered for a moment, "I don’t think it’s just about President Gu putting on airs as a boss, he might be more worried about his personal safety... "

Zhuge Jun thought for a second, "...That makes sense."

He also felt that President Gu was quite approachable and easily mingled with players. It wasn’t like him to distance himself from the community just because a game was successful.

Previous Nitiandang games had been hits, and yet President Gu regularly visited the experience store.

So maybe it was the poor ratings of Endless Fantasy Legend 2 that kept him away...

Right from the announcement to the beta testing, there had been many voices skeptical about the game.

The good news was, as soon as the beta launched, these skeptical voices got drowned out.

The bad news was, they were overshadowed by even worse criticism!

Especially when one UP’s gacha tore cards, and another character’s legendary quest continued to tear cards, treating players like dogs, the forums were just short of cursing to the heavens.

Who taught you to make a gacha game like this!

Beyond that, many hardcore single-player gamers expressed strong outrage at Nitiandang’s move, considering it a degeneration, a betrayal of all single-player gamers.

How could a solid single-player game company stoop to making mobile games?

And gacha mobile games that require in-game purchases at that!

Disgusting! Just one word, disgusting!

In the eyes of these players, Nitiandang’s previous sincere single-player games did not earn them immunity; instead, they stood as evidence of an even greater sin.

In any case, once the beta ended, the reputation of Endless Fantasy Legend 2 became highly polarized, with some slamming it to the bottom and others lifting it halfway up the mountain.

Why just halfway up the mountain?

Well, that’s as far as mobile games could be elevated, after all.

Online, there were indeed players who thought Endless Fantasy Legend 2 wasn’t bad, mainly mobile gamers.

Because they had never seen such a high-caliber game on a smartphone!

Whether it was the game’s scale, mechanics, open-world gameplay, or the optimization and interoperability across devices, it was an entire generation ahead of other mobile games of the time.

Many said it was like a dimension-reducing strike from a single-player game company making mobile games!

Others said it had nothing to do with being a single-player game company. There were so many of them; didn’t they want to make money from mobile games too? They did, but maybe they just didn’t have the capability.

Nitiandang was different; they had the capability.

So, it was best not to view Nitiandang as any ordinary single-player game company. They aimed much higher than that.

The voices online didn’t impact Nitiandang in the slightest; the game continued as planned and launched on schedule.

After all, Nitiandang had long been immune to criticism; since its inception, it faced constant complaints, but while gamers grumbled, they kept playing, and now Nitiandang’s reputation was better than ever.

Soon, Zhuge Jun and Hou Ji were ready to dive into the game.

But just then, they noticed that there seemed to be a new batch of merchandise on the countertop of the experience store.

These items weren’t as flashy as action figures or large models, appearing rather understated; they had been preoccupied with grabbing seats earlier and overlooked them.

"Is this physical merchandise for ’Endless Fantasy Legend 2’?" Zhuge Jun curiously approached the counter.

The shop assistant explained earnestly, "Yes, there are two tie-in products for ’Endless Fantasy Legend 2’. The first is an interactive controller, which you can try out freely in the experience store.

"The second is this physical book. You cannot just try this out; it is only for purchase.

"There are three price tiers:

"Just buying the book costs 39 yuan; however, if you want to integrate it with the game and enjoy some special features, you’ll need to use it in conjunction with a reading pen or the interactive controller.

"The package of the book and reading pen is 198 yuan, and the bundle with the book and controller is 498 yuan."

Zhuge Jun took a look. It seemed to be a very large, very thick physical book, a genuine tome, with a design similar to pop-up books and art concept albums.

As for its basic content, it wasn’t hard to guess that it definitely included the art and concept design collection of ’Endless Fantasy Legend 2’.

As for the specific interactive game features? That was still unknown.

"This is pretty interesting, okay, I’ll take one."

Zhuge Jun bought just the book, as after all, the interactive controllers could be used for free within the experience store, so there was no immediate need to buy a reading pen.

Speaking of which, the design of that reading pen was also quite unique. It wasn’t the more childish kind usually found with children’s educational books; instead, it had adopted the fantasy style of ’Endless Fantasy Legend,’ appealing to both young and old.

After taking the thick book back to his seat, Zhuge Jun started to unwrap it.

Turning the pages, the content inside was indeed diverse and quite elaborate.

The book was roughly divided into more than ten Chapters, each spanning 4 to 6 pages.

At the start of each Chapter, there was a pop-up design. As soon as you turned it, you would see special terrain and buildings pop up from the pages, the display effect was actually quite good.

For instance, in the East’s Wood Country, the right half-page was mostly towering trees and lush forests, while the center featured the original King’s City, and in the lower-left corner was a volcano.

The entire main storyline terrain of Wood Country was basically depicted.

The following pages seemed to correspond to the side quests and collectible elements of this region, and the design of these pages was more whimsical, each Chapter distinct from the others.

According to the instructions, the whole book was interactive.

The interactive controller didn’t look to have any significant features at first glance, or you could say it was full of features.

Like its tie-in game ’Endless Fantasy Legend 2,’ the controller was a true frankenstein creation.

The controller manufacturer had adopted a detachable modular design, allowing for the addition of mini steering controls, trigger paddles, and other extra functionalities that previous controllers featured.

Of course, the initial version didn’t include these miscellaneous items, and it just came with extra accessories like a high joystick cap, wide joystick cap, and a replaceable d-pad. If you wanted to use trigger paddles and other accessories to play ’Blood of Lies,’ you’d need to purchase them separately.

Its color scheme was also done to match the style of ’Endless Fantasy Legend 2.’

In terms of price, the bundle of the controller and book was sold for 498 yuan, with the book itself costing 39 yuan, making the actual price of the controller around 459 yuan, roughly equivalent to previous co-branded controllers in price.

After all, the trigger-paddle edition controller for ’Blood of Lies’ was 549 yuan, so after deducting the trigger paddles, the prices of these two were rather similar.

However, the ’Endless Fantasy Legend 2’ interactive controller had one feature previous controllers did not – it could be used as a reading pen.

On the pointed end where the left hand holds the controller, there was a special scanning area that could directly scan any area of the physical book and produce a corresponding effect.

"Looks pretty good, quite novel.

"Let’s give it a scan and see.

"Oh, I have to be in the game for it to work."

Zhuge Jun tried scanning right away with the controller, only to find that he needed to enter the game and bind the physical book to his account first.

The binding process was also quite simple: just log in to the account, then scan a specific spot on the front page of the book, and the binding information would pop up.

So Zhuge Jun put the hefty book aside for the moment, ready to dive into the game experience.

Meanwhile, Hou Ji had already stepped into the game ahead of him.

As for Zhuge Jun’s physical book, he only had four words to describe it.

"All flash and no substance."
